Trump and Xi Jinping Agreed That Iran Can Never Have a Nuclear Weapon – Says White House

 

Source: Africa Publicity

US President, Donald Trump and his Chinese counterpart, Xi Jinping, have agreed that “Iran can never have a nuclear weapon”, the White House said in a statement.

In the statement issued on Thursday, May 14, 2026 on the outcomes of the President Jinping and Trump’s bilateral meeting held in Beijing, China, the White House disclosed that “President Xi also made clear China’s opposition to the militarization of the Strait and any effort to charge a toll for its use.”

According to the statement, the Chinese President “expressed interest in purchasing more American oil to reduce China’s dependence on the Strait in the future.”

It says Presidents Trump and Jinping discussed ways to enhance economic cooperation between China and the United States, “including expanding market access for American businesses into China and increasing Chinese investment info our industries.”
